I haven't followed boxing in a good while, Are the Klitschko brothers still Heavyweight champions?

Yep. Vitali fought and beat a Cuban named Solis (former Olympic champ I believe). I watched the fight (the whole 3 minutes) the other day on Foxtel. It was a bit unfortunate - Vitali got a half decent shot in, Solis moved back, slipped and did his knee.

They ruled it a TKO (the ruling was Solis fell as a result of the punch) but it was more a no contest. Solis clearly slipped. Shame as Solis was 17-0 and it's a crappy way to lose for the first time. Hopefully there will be a rematch when Solis is fit.
